Westlake Corporation Advances Sustainability Goals Toward 2030 Carbon-Reduction Target

HOUSTON--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Westlake Corporation (NYSE: WLK) today announced an advance in the company’s sustainability objectives to further reduce its carbon emissions intensity by 20% by 2030, from a 2016 baseline, which is one of the company’s sustainability goals.

Westlake recently entered into an agreement with a solar renewable-energy three-farm project that generates approximately 160,000 megawatt-hours per year of renewable energy and purchased the associated renewable energy certificates (RECs). The RECs are utilized as part of this multi-year purchase agreement to offset Westlake’s electricity consumption attributed to powering its operations. Westlake is evaluating the best use of REC’s to enhance its downstream product offerings.

“The incorporation of purchased RECs into our broader sustainability strategy is an important step in our ongoing efforts to cut greenhouse gas emissions,” said Tim Hunt, Vice President, Corporate Development and Sustainability. “This initiative not only advances our own sustainability objectives but also supports our customers’ goals of decreasing emissions across their value chains while helping to drive the growth of renewable energy.”
